Amazing New Album from our Soundtrack Composer, Occams Laser

The original board game of The Captain is Dead has an amazing art style, almost like an old, low-poly video game... which made it a no-brainer for us to go with the same, retro style for the digital version. The soundtrack, however, was not such an easy decision...

We were originally looking for an epic, space opera feel, reminiscent of James Horner's fantastic score for Star Trek II - The Wrath of Khan, but when we first heard the cinematic synthwave sound of "Warriors of The Faith" by Occams Laser it hit us: why not echo the retro visuals with the soundtrack? After a quick listen to his (rather amazing) back catalog, we were suitably impressed, and reached out to him to see what he thought of an early version of our game. Fortunately he loved it, and the rest, as they say, is history.

Occam has a new album out this week, called New Blood II. Whilst we're ever so slightly disappointed that it doesn't have the subtitle "Even Newer Blood", we've been listening to it on endless repeat all week, so he must be doing something right! And, if you're already familiar with the prequel album, you'll recognize a couple of tracks from it in The Captain is Dead.
